summaryrefslogtreecommitdiff
path: root/src/socket.c
diff options
context:
space:
mode:
authorLennart Poettering <lennart@poettering.net>2011-03-31 15:35:40 +0200
committerLennart Poettering <lennart@poettering.net>2011-03-31 15:35:40 +0200
commitda19d5c19f60ec80e1733b1e994311c59c6eda73 (patch)
tree1df3b703d728471e1051e23778f857bf4adff23f /src/socket.c
parentba1a55152c50dfbcd3d4a64353b95f4a2f37985e (diff)
src: our lord is coverity
Diffstat (limited to 'src/socket.c')
-rw-r--r--src/socket.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/socket.c b/src/socket.c
index 72be0e2235..beb328657f 100644
--- a/src/socket.c
+++ b/src/socket.c
@@ -1066,6 +1066,7 @@ static void socket_enter_signal(Socket *s, SocketState state, bool success) {
wait_for_exit = true;
set_free(pid_set);
+ pid_set = NULL;
}
}
@@ -1695,6 +1696,7 @@ static void socket_timer_event(Unit *u, uint64_t elapsed, Watch *w) {
case SOCKET_START_PRE:
log_warning("%s starting timed out. Terminating.", u->meta.id);
socket_enter_signal(s, SOCKET_FINAL_SIGTERM, false);
+ break;
case SOCKET_START_POST:
log_warning("%s starting timed out. Stopping.", u->meta.id);